Owls Soar Back To World Series
Community News Desk | May 22, 2026
The Oakton College Owls are flying back to the national stage after capturing the 2026 NJCAA Division III Great Lakes District Championship and securing a second consecutive trip to the NJCAA Division III World Series. Fueled by explosive offense, dominant pitching and a close-knit team culture, the Owls are ready to take another swing at a national title.... READ MORE >

Maine West Art Teacher Honored For Inspiring Students
Community News Desk | May 21, 2026
Maine West High School art teacher Chuy Benitez was among eight local educators recently recognized in the 2026 Scholastic Art and Writing Awards Chicago Regional Ceremony at Columbia College Chicago for having the highest number of individual student art award recipients.
